Housing costs

Rents, mortgages and crowding.

Typical costs are quite low here, with weekly rents of $270 and monthly mortgage payments of $1,300. Both figures are well below those found across Queensland and the rest of Australia.

Owning & renting

How homes are owned or rented.

Renting is much more common in Wandal than in most areas, with 32.5% of households renting. This is consistent with a lower percentage of homes owned outright, which sits at 27.9%.

Types of homes

Houses, townhouses, apartments and bedrooms.

Separate houses make up 88.3% of the market, far above the state and national figures. However, homes here tend to be smaller, as the 67.3% of dwellings with three or more bedrooms is well below the national average.
